Hotline To Be Considered With Pakistani Border Forces

June 18 2012

India

The Indian Border Security Force (BSF) supports the establishment of a hotline with Pakistan to avoid misunderstanding on border firing incidents, reports the Calcutta Telegraph.

The hotline proposal is expected to be discussed by the heads of the BSF and Pakistani Rangers on July 1 in New Delhi, said Indian officials.

The hotline would allow field commanders to talk on the phone instead of waiting for flag meetings in case of firing or other border incidents.
